Job Description

The position of Director, Advancement and Public Affairs requires someone who is dynamic, conversant with information communication technology, outgoing and able to market the University and its products. The Director shall also ensure the effective and efficient execution of efforts to grow philanthropic investment in the University from local and international sources. Key areas of focus/responsibility shall include, Resource mobilization across Africa (making friends and raising funds for Bindura University of Science Education), Public Affairs, Marketing, and Alumni Relations

Duties and Responsibilities

Duties and Responsibilities:

Reporting to the Vice Chancellor, the Director, Advancement and Public Affairs shall be responsible for but not limited to the following:

Promotion of University products and services;
Development and implementation of the communication strategy of the University;
Assist in the development of communication and promotion campaigns and materials;
Produce and distribute publications such as the Prospectus, University calendar, Annual reports, newsletters, facts and figures;
Execute relationship-building and fundraising activities to meet the University’s resource mobilization goals;
Implement and manage campus-based policies, processes and procedures for donor research and donor cultivation, solicitation and stewardship;
Enhance a culture of philanthropy within the University Community and its Alumni;
Oversee University-wide media relations, including preparing news releases, statements, and other materials; encouraging media coverage of the University’s accomplishments/successes and contributions; and ensuring timely and effective handling of media calls and requests;
Serving on University Committees as advised by the Vice Chancellor;

Qualifications and Experience

Qualifications and Experience

Master’s degree in Media and Marketing Communication/Marketing Management/Public Relations/Business Administration/Business Leadership/Public Administration/ Development /Institutional Advancement or equivalent;
First degree in Media and Marketing Communication/Public Relations and Marketing/ Development/Institutional Advancement or its equivalent;
Minimum of five (5) years post qualification experience conducting direct responsibilities in institutional advancement arena, and at least three (3) years of which one should have been in supervisory management.

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ities Preferred:

A proven track record of fundraising success in Zimbabwe and beyond borders especially documented solicitation and delivery of numerous major gifts;
Experience in higher education and/or nonprofit making sector;
Excellent communication and presentation skills with confidence to serve as the University’s spokesperson;
High ethical standards and ability to handle confidential/sensitive gift and donor information appropriately;
Exceptional interpersonal skills and the ability to interact effectively with high level stakeholders such as Board members and members of the national accrediting authority as well as prospects, donors, students, faculties, alumni and University friends from all walks of life;
Ability to exercise good judgment, to demonstrate an understanding of and respect for the professional Code of Ethics related to advancement, and to use discretion in interactions with donors, prospects, volunteers, and others;
Experience in working with software applications relevant to the advancement profession;
Competence or openness to learning the most widely-spoken languages in Zimbabwe.
